In today's digital age, making friends online has become a norm. With the rise of social media platforms and online communities, people can connect with others from all over the world with just a few clicks. One such phenomenon that has gained popularity in recent years is "Mujhse Dosti Karoge Online" - a phrase that translates to "Will You Be Friends with Me Online?" in English.

Mujhse Dosti Karoge Online is a concept that originated on social media platforms, particularly on Twitter and Instagram. It's a way for people to reach out to others, often strangers, and initiate a conversation with the intention of forming a new friendship. The phrase has become a sort of icebreaker, allowing people to break the ice and start a conversation with someone they may not have met otherwise.
